Truman in the News
July 30, 2021

The Biden administration has a life-or-death decision to make about Afghanistan

The Biden administration has a life-or-death decision to make about Afghanistan
Upcoming
PAST
Truman in the News
July
30
,
2021

The Biden administration has a life-or-death decision to make about Afghanistan

The Biden administration has a life-or-death decision to make about Afghanistan

The Biden administration has a life-or-death decision to make about Afghanistan

The Biden administration has a life-or-death decision to make about Afghanistan

The Biden administration has a life-or-death decision to make about Afghanistan